Possible Causes of Water Damage to Tile and Grout

Water damage to tiled surfaces can occur for various reasons, especially when tiles or grout are compromised. One common cause is plumbing leaks under sinks, behind walls, or from broken pipes that seep into the tile installations. When water infiltrates these areas, it can cause the grout to weaken and tiles to loosen over time, leading to extensive damage if not addressed promptly.

Another frequent cause is water intrusion from flooding or heavy rainfall. Poorly sealed or cracked tiles and grout lines allow water to penetrate beneath the surface, pooling in the subfloor or affecting the underlying structure. This is particularly problematic in areas like bathrooms and kitchens, where water exposure is constant or frequent. Failing to repair these issues quickly can lead to mold growth and structural deterioration, making early intervention crucial.

How Our Experts Can Fix Tile and Grout Water Damage

Our team begins with a thorough assessment to identify the extent of the water damage, checking both visible and hidden areas beneath the tiles. We utilize advanced moisture detection tools to pinpoint moisture buildup, ensuring no damage goes unnoticed. Once the problem areas are identified, we develop a customized plan for repair and restoration.

To repair water-damaged tiles and grout, we carefully remove compromised sections to prevent further damage. Our experts then thoroughly dry the affected area using industrial-grade drying equipment, which prevents mold growth and structural issues. After drying, we reapply high-quality grout and sealants to restore the appearance and protect against future water intrusion.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my tile and grout has water damage?

If you notice discoloration, loose tiles, or a musty smell in your tiled areas, these could be signs of water damage. Additionally, water seeping through grout lines or beneath tiles during leaks or heavy rain indicates the need for professional inspection. Will I need to replace my tiles after water damage?

Not necessarily. Many water-damaged tiles can be repaired or retreated if the damage is not structural. However, severely affected tiles that are cracked, loose, or mold-infested may need replacement to ensure safety and durability. Our experts will advise you on the best course of action.
